logo

Output 23f6128fcd00d215b8f552a9ee4a738c0b2529881bed92e94dd0de187e750be4:111

value
9863029
script pubkey
OP_0 OP_PUSHBYTES_20 c70dabd0422a7b0b24e72077f0b30ecaccfdee17
address
bc1qcux6h5zz9faskf88ypmlpvcwetx0mmshrn3y60
transaction
23f6128fcd00d215b8f552a9ee4a738c0b2529881bed92e94dd0de187e750be4